Kei’trel Clark, Louisville’s 4th-year junior cornerback, was selected in the 6th Round of the 2023 NFL Draft with the 180th-overall pick by the Arizona Cardinals. Clark started his career at Liberty University prior to transferring to Louisville for the 2020 season. A three time All-ACC selection (2020 2nd Team, 2021 2nd Team, 2022 3rd Team),…
